The Winners' Circle for May 2009

Chateau Beauvallon ranks tops with Expedia users

MONT TREMBLANT, QC—Expedia travellers have ranked Chateau Beauvallon as the world’s best hotel on this year’s Expedia Insiders’ Select list. The boutique hotel received an almost perfect score of 99.99 out of a possible 100 on the list that recognizes individual hotels worldwide that consistently deliver excellent service, a great overall experience and a notable value.
 
To celebrate its achievement, Chateau Beauvallon is offering clients the chance to experience the hotel at a fraction of the cost.  A special Expedia rate of $99.99 is now available for new bookings until June.

“We are thrilled to be ranked so highly by Expedia travellers,’”says Anne Larcade, president and COO of Sequel Lifestyle Hotels and Resorts, the management company that operates Chateau Beauvallon.

“As a lifestyle company, this recognition strengthens our commitment to offering our guests an experience that appeals to all six senses. It is our intuitive service and commitment to a balanced lifestyle that our guests say bring them back to our properties—guests feel this vibe and appreciate the great value,” she adds.

Chef Christopher Marz is SilverBirch leader of the year

OTTAWA, ON—The Crowne Plaza Ottawa’s executive chef Christopher Marz has received the “2008 Leader of the  Year” award from SilverBirch Hotels & Resorts. This award is given to an  individual who is in a leadership role, has been recognized as a Coach of the  Quarter under the SilverBirch Champions in Action recognition program, and  has made significant contributions in the spirit of the SilverBirch  championship philosophy.

 Marz joined the culinary  team as executive chef at 101 Café & Bar four years ago. In addition to excelling as a leader in the hotel, chef Marz has been actively involved in the Ottawa community, as part of Toques Blanches, Chefs Association as well as teaching future culinary teams at Algonquin College.

Marz also donates  his time to the Chef’s Charity Café, an initiative that supports families with sick children and provides supplies to the homeless, as well as offers  scholarships to local hospitality and tourism students.  His volunteer  efforts have had a positive impact on the other associates at the hotel,  encouraging them to become more involved in their community as well.
 
Chef Marz is originally from Montréal and spent seven years learning about the culinary arts in Lindau, Germany and Cork, Ireland.

YYZ Sheraton Gateway is the chain’s hotel of the year

TORONTO—Starwood Hotels & Resorts Worldwide, Inc. presented the Sheraton Gateway Hotel Toronto International Airport with the coveted “Sheraton Hotel of the Year” award at a recent celebration held at the St. Regis Hotel in New York City.
 
Joumana Ghandour, general manager of the 474-room Gateway property received the award in person at the evening ceremony in Manhattan.
 
Award criteria included guest satisfaction index rating, quality assurance ranking, revenue management and overall brand experience metrics for the hotel’s guests and clients.
“I was thrilled to accept the award on behalf of my entire team at the Sheraton Gateway”, said Ghandour. “I would like to thank our dedicated associates and all our loyal guests and clients, without whom this honour would not have been possible.”
